Myanmar Daily Weather Report

(Issued at 7:00 am on Friday 26th May, 2017)

BAY INFERENCE: According to the observations at (06:30)hrs M.S.T today, the low pressure area  over the Southeast Bay and adjoining Central Bay of Bengal  still persists. Monsoon is moderate to strong over the Andaman Sea and Southeast Bay. Weather is a few cloud over the North Bay and partly cloudy to cloudy elsewhere over the Bay of Bengal.

FORECAST VALID UNTIL EVENING OF THE 26th May, 2017: Rain or thundershowers will be widespread in Taninthayi Region, Kayin and Mon States, fairly widespread in Bago, Yangon and Ayeyarwady Regions, scattered in  Naypyitaw, Sagaing,Mandalay Regions, Kachin, Shan ,Rakhine and Kayah States and isolated in the remaining Regions and States. Degree of certainly is (80%).

STATE OF THE SEA: Squalls with moderate to rough seas are likely at times off and along Mon-Taninthayi Coasts. Surface wind speed in squalls may reach (30-35) m.p.h.  Sea will be moderate elsewhere in Myanmar water.

OUTLOOK FOR SUBSEQUENT TWO DAYS: Increase of rain in Taninthayi Region and Mon State.

FORECAST FOR NAYPYITAW AND NEIGHBOURING AREA FOR 26th May, 2017: Isolated rain or thundershowers. Degree of certainly is (80%).

FORECAST FOR YANGON AND NEIGHBOURING AREA FOR 26th May, 2017: Isolated rain or thundershowers. Degree of certainly is (80%).

FORECAST FOR MANDALAY AND NEIGHBOURING AREA FOR 26th May, 2017: Isolated rain or thundershowers. Degree of certainly is (80%)
